Castor oil is derived from the seeds of the Ricinus communis plant. It is uniquely rich in ricinoleic acid, a monounsaturated fatty acid that acts as a powerful humectant. This means it doesn’t just sit on top of your skin; it actually draws moisture from the air into your skin tissue, keeping you hydrated for hours.
Many beginners feel a bit hesitant because pure castor oil is quite thick and sticky. Don’t let that deter you! When properly blended with other “carrier” oils and butters, that thickness transforms into a rich, protective barrier that helps heal the skin’s natural moisture barrier. Section 2: Step-by-Step Process for a Creamy DIY Lotion
Creating your own lotion might sound like a complex chemistry experiment, but it is actually a very achievable DIY project. This “Whipped Body Butter” method is the core technique for achieving smooth, hydrated skin.
Tool and Ingredient Requirements
- A Hand Mixer or Stand Mixer: Essential for achieving that light, fluffy texture.
- A Double Boiler: (Or a glass bowl over a pot of simmering water) to gently melt the fats.
- 1/2 cup Shea Butter: This provides a creamy base and deep nourishment.
- 1/4 cup Coconut Oil: For easy spreadability and antimicrobial benefits.
- 1/4 cup Castor Oil: The star ingredient for intense hydration.
- 10 drops Essential Oil: (Optional) Lavender or Frankincense work beautifully for skincare.
Step-by-Step Core Method
- Melt the Fats: Place the shea butter and coconut oil in your double boiler. Heat gently until they are completely liquid.
- Incorporate the Castor Oil: Once melted, remove from heat and stir in the castor oil. This ensures the ricinoleic acid isn’t over-exposed to high heat.
- The Cooling Phase: Place the mixture in the refrigerator for about 45–60 minutes. You want it to be partially set—opaque and firm, but still soft enough to press a finger into.
- Whip It Up: Add your essential oils. Use your hand mixer to whip the mixture on high speed for 5–10 minutes. You will see it transform from a yellow oil into a white, fluffy cream that looks like frosting!
- Store: Spoon your lotion into a clean glass jar.
Timing and Planning
Because this recipe doesn’t contain water, it has a surprisingly long shelf life of about 6–8 months. It is best to apply it right after a shower when your skin is slightly damp to “lock in” that extra moisture.
Section 3: Pro Tips for Advanced Customization
Once you have mastered the basic whipped recipe, you can share expert-level insights by customizing your DIY Castor Oil Lotion Recipes for Smooth Hydrated Skin to meet specific needs. Skincare is not one-size-fits-all, and these pro tips will help you tailor your approach.
- For Anti-Aging: Swap the coconut oil for Rosehip Seed oil. Rosehip is a natural source of retinol and works synergistically with castor oil to diminish fine lines and age spots.
- For Ultra-Sensitive Skin: Omit the essential oils and add a tablespoon of Vitamin E oil. This provides a “barrier cream” effect that is perfect for those who react to fragrances.
- The Beeswax Hack: If you live in a very warm climate, your lotion might melt. To prevent this, add 1 tablespoon of beeswax pellets during the melting phase. This will give your lotion a firmer, more stable structure that stays creamy even in summer heat.
H3: Achieving the Perfect Absorption
If you find the lotion takes a few minutes to sink in, try adding a teaspoon of arrowroot powder during the whipping phase. This expert shortcut cuts the greasiness and leaves your skin with a “silky” finish rather than an oily one.
Section 4: Troubleshooting Common Challenges
Even the best DIY projects can face obstacles. If your first batch isn’t perfect, don’t worry! These solutions will help you stay on track toward achieving smooth, hydrated skin.
- Problem: “My lotion turned back into a liquid.”
- Solution: This usually happens if the oils weren’t cooled long enough before whipping. Simply put the jar back in the fridge until it’s firm, then re-whip it. It will fluff right back up!
- Problem: “The texture feels grainy.”
- Solution: Shea butter can sometimes go “grainy” if it cools too slowly. To prevent this next time, try cooling the mixture in the freezer for a faster temperature drop. You can fix a grainy batch by re-melting it and cooling it more quickly.
- Problem: “The scent is too strong.”
- Solution: Since essential oils are potent, always start with fewer drops. If a batch is already too strong, you can “dilute” it by whipping in a bit more plain shea butter or castor oil.
Preventive Measures
Always ensure your glass jars are completely dry before filling them. Even a tiny drop of water can introduce bacteria into an oil-based lotion. By keeping things dry and clean, you ensure your DIY creation stays fresh and safe.
